As our Treasury Manager, you will take ownership of the group's treasury operations and play a key role in shaping its financial strategy. You will ensure that our group's financial resources are managed strategically and effectively, supporting our mission to make a lasting impact. Your responsibilities will include:

Managing cash flow:


Develop, implement, and actively monitor cash flow plans to ensure financial sustainability.
Identify and implement effective solutions for optimizing liquidity across subsidiaries.


Building strategic bank relationships:


Establish and nurture relationships with financial institutions to support debt-raising activities.
Secure financing solutions aligned with the organization's growth objectives.


Driving treasury excellence:


Design and execute a robust treasury management policy tailored to the group's needs.
Review and optimize governance, systems, and processes to enhance efficiency.


Leading the treasury committee:


Organize and chair weekly group treasury management committee meetings, driving actionable outcomes.


Providing strategic insights:


Prepare and deliver consolidated financial reports on treasury activities and key performance indicators.
Proactively manage treasury operations to minimize capital costs and enhance financial efficiency.
